What type of ship is this?

SINTAMI (IMO 9435430) is a Oil service/AHTS ship built in 2007 and is sailing under the flag of Mongolia. She has an overall length (LOA) of 35 meters and a width (beam) of 10 meters. Her summer deadweight capacity is 100 tonnes.
